/**
 * SystemService that publishes an IVoiceInteractionManagerService.
 */
public class VoiceInteractionManagerService extends SystemService {
    static final String TAG = "VoiceInteractionManagerService";
    static final boolean DEBUG = false;

    final Context mContext;
    final ContentResolver mResolver;
    final DatabaseHelper mDbHelper;
    final SoundTriggerHelper mSoundTriggerHelper;

    public VoiceInteractionManagerService(Context context) {
        super(context);
        mContext = context;
        mResolver = context.getContentResolver();
        mDbHelper = new DatabaseHelper(context);
        mSoundTriggerHelper = new SoundTriggerHelper(context);
    }

    @Override
    public void onStart() {
        publishBinderService(Context.VOICE_INTERACTION_MANAGER_SERVICE, mServiceStub);
    }

    @Override
    public void onBootPhase(int phase) {
        if (phase == PHASE_THIRD_PARTY_APPS_CAN_START) {
            mServiceStub.systemRunning(isSafeMode());
        }
    }

    @Override
    public void onStartUser(int userHandle) {
        mServiceStub.initForUser(userHandle);
    }

    @Override
    public void onSwitchUser(int userHandle) {
        mServiceStub.switchUser(userHandle);
    }

    // implementation entry point and binder service
    private final VoiceInteractionManagerServiceStub mServiceStub
            = new VoiceInteractionManagerServiceStub();

    class VoiceInteractionManagerServiceStub extends IVoiceInteractionManagerService.Stub {

        VoiceInteractionManagerServiceImpl mImpl;

        private boolean mSafeMode;
        private int mCurUser;

        @Override
        public boolean onTransact(int code, Parcel data, Parcel reply, int flags)
                throws RemoteException {
            try {
                return super.onTransact(code, data, reply, flags);
            } catch (RuntimeException e) {
                // The activity manager only throws security exceptions, so let's
                // log all others.
                if (!(e instanceof SecurityException)) {
                    Slog.wtf(TAG, "VoiceInteractionManagerService Crash", e);
                }
                throw e;
            }
        }

        public void initForUser(int userHandle) {
            if (DEBUG) Slog.i(TAG, "initForUser user=" + userHandle);
            String curInteractorStr = Settings.Secure.getStringForUser(
                    mContext.getContentResolver(),
                    Settings.Secure.VOICE_INTERACTION_SERVICE, userHandle);
            ComponentName curRecognizer = getCurRecognizer(userHandle);
            VoiceInteractionServiceInfo curInteractorInfo = null;
            if (curInteractorStr == null && curRecognizer != null
                    && !ActivityManager.isLowRamDeviceStatic()) {
                // If there is no interactor setting, that means we are upgrading
                // from an older platform version.  If the current recognizer is not
                // set or matches the preferred recognizer, then we want to upgrade
                // the user to have the default voice interaction service enabled.
                // Note that we don't do this for low-RAM devices, since we aren't
                // supporting voice interaction services there.
                curInteractorInfo = findAvailInteractor(userHandle, curRecognizer);
                if (curInteractorInfo != null) {
                    // Looks good!  We'll apply this one.  To make it happen, we clear the
                    // recognizer so that we don't think we have anything set and will
                    // re-apply the settings.
                    curRecognizer = null;
                }
            }

            // If we are on a svelte device, make sure an interactor is not currently
            // enabled; if it is, turn it off.
            if (ActivityManager.isLowRamDeviceStatic() && curInteractorStr != null) {
                if (!TextUtils.isEmpty(curInteractorStr)) {
                    setCurInteractor(null, userHandle);
                    curInteractorStr = "";
                }
            }

            if (curRecognizer != null) {
                // If we already have at least a recognizer, then we probably want to
                // leave things as they are...  unless something has disappeared.
                IPackageManager pm = AppGlobals.getPackageManager();
                ServiceInfo interactorInfo = null;
                ServiceInfo recognizerInfo = null;
                ComponentName curInteractor = !TextUtils.isEmpty(curInteractorStr)
                        ? ComponentName.unflattenFromString(curInteractorStr) : null;
                try {
                    recognizerInfo = pm.getServiceInfo(curRecognizer, 0, userHandle);
                    if (curInteractor != null) {
                        interactorInfo = pm.getServiceInfo(curInteractor, 0, userHandle);
                    }
                } catch (RemoteException e) {
                }
                // If the apps for the currently set components still exist, then all is okay.
                if (recognizerInfo != null && (curInteractor == null || interactorInfo != null)) {
                    return;
                }
            }

            // Initializing settings, look for an interactor first (but only on non-svelte).
            if (curInteractorInfo == null && !ActivityManager.isLowRamDeviceStatic()) {
                curInteractorInfo = findAvailInteractor(userHandle, null);
            }

            if (curInteractorInfo != null) {
                // Eventually it will be an error to not specify this.
                setCurInteractor(new ComponentName(curInteractorInfo.getServiceInfo().packageName,
                        curInteractorInfo.getServiceInfo().name), userHandle);
                if (curInteractorInfo.getRecognitionService() != null) {
                    setCurRecognizer(
                            new ComponentName(curInteractorInfo.getServiceInfo().packageName,
                                    curInteractorInfo.getRecognitionService()), userHandle);
                    return;
                }
            }

            // No voice interactor, we'll just set up a simple recognizer.
            curRecognizer = findAvailRecognizer(null, userHandle);
            if (curRecognizer != null) {
                if (curInteractorInfo == null) {
                    setCurInteractor(null, userHandle);
                }
                setCurRecognizer(curRecognizer, userHandle);
            }
        }

        public void systemRunning(boolean safeMode) {
            mSafeMode = safeMode;

            mPackageMonitor.register(mContext, BackgroundThread.getHandler().getLooper(),
                    UserHandle.ALL, true);
            new SettingsObserver(UiThread.getHandler());

            synchronized (this) {
                mCurUser = ActivityManager.getCurrentUser();
                switchImplementationIfNeededLocked(false);
            }
        }

        public void switchUser(int userHandle) {
            synchronized (this) {
                mCurUser = userHandle;
                switchImplementationIfNeededLocked(false);
            }
        }

        void switchImplementationIfNeededLocked(boolean force) {
            if (!mSafeMode) {
                String curService = Settings.Secure.getStringForUser(
                        mResolver, Settings.Secure.VOICE_INTERACTION_SERVICE, mCurUser);
                ComponentName serviceComponent = null;
                if (curService != null && !curService.isEmpty()) {
                    try {
                        serviceComponent = ComponentName.unflattenFromString(curService);
                    } catch (RuntimeException e) {
                        Slog.wtf(TAG, "Bad voice interaction service name " + curService, e);
                        serviceComponent = null;
                    }
                }
                if (force || mImpl == null || mImpl.mUser != mCurUser
                        || !mImpl.mComponent.equals(serviceComponent)) {
                    mSoundTriggerHelper.stopAllRecognitions();
                    if (mImpl != null) {
                        mImpl.shutdownLocked();
                    }
                    if (serviceComponent != null) {
                        mImpl = new VoiceInteractionManagerServiceImpl(mContext,
                                UiThread.getHandler(), this, mCurUser, serviceComponent);
                        mImpl.startLocked();
                    } else {
                        mImpl = null;
                    }
                }
            }
        }

        VoiceInteractionServiceInfo findAvailInteractor(int userHandle, ComponentName recognizer) {
            List<ResolveInfo> available =
                    mContext.getPackageManager().queryIntentServicesAsUser(
                            new Intent(VoiceInteractionService.SERVICE_INTERFACE), 0, userHandle);
            int numAvailable = available.size();

            if (numAvailable == 0) {
                Slog.w(TAG, "no available voice interaction services found for user " + userHandle);
                return null;
            } else {
                // Find first system package.  We never want to allow third party services to
                // be automatically selected, because those require approval of the user.
                VoiceInteractionServiceInfo foundInfo = null;
                for (int i=0; i<numAvailable; i++) {
                    ServiceInfo cur = available.get(i).serviceInfo;
                    if ((cur.applicationInfo.flags&ApplicationInfo.FLAG_SYSTEM) != 0) {
                        ComponentName comp = new ComponentName(cur.packageName, cur.name);
                        try {
                            VoiceInteractionServiceInfo info = new VoiceInteractionServiceInfo(
                                    mContext.getPackageManager(), comp, userHandle);
                            if (info.getParseError() == null) {
                                if (recognizer == null || info.getServiceInfo().packageName.equals(
                                        recognizer.getPackageName())) {
                                    if (foundInfo == null) {
                                        foundInfo = info;
                                    } else {
                                        Slog.w(TAG, "More than one voice interaction service, "
                                                + "picking first "
                                                + new ComponentName(
                                                        foundInfo.getServiceInfo().packageName,
                                                        foundInfo.getServiceInfo().name)
                                                + " over "
                                                + new ComponentName(cur.packageName, cur.name));
                                    }
                                }
                            } else {
                                Slog.w(TAG, "Bad interaction service " + comp + ": "
                                        + info.getParseError());
                            }
                        } catch (PackageManager.NameNotFoundException e) {
                            Slog.w(TAG, "Failure looking up interaction service " + comp);
                        } catch (RemoteException e) {
                        }
                    }
                }

                return foundInfo;
            }
        }

        ComponentName getCurInteractor(int userHandle) {
            String curInteractor = Settings.Secure.getStringForUser(
                    mContext.getContentResolver(),
                    Settings.Secure.VOICE_INTERACTION_SERVICE, userHandle);
            if (TextUtils.isEmpty(curInteractor)) {
                return null;
            }
            if (DEBUG) Slog.i(TAG, "getCurInteractor curInteractor=" + curInteractor
                    + " user=" + userHandle);
            return ComponentName.unflattenFromString(curInteractor);
        }

        void setCurInteractor(ComponentName comp, int userHandle) {
            Settings.Secure.putStringForUser(mContext.getContentResolver(),
                    Settings.Secure.VOICE_INTERACTION_SERVICE,
                    comp != null ? comp.flattenToShortString() : "", userHandle);
            if (DEBUG) Slog.i(TAG, "setCurInteractor comp=" + comp
                    + " user=" + userHandle);
        }

        ComponentName findAvailRecognizer(String prefPackage, int userHandle) {
            List<ResolveInfo> available =
                    mContext.getPackageManager().queryIntentServicesAsUser(
                            new Intent(RecognitionService.SERVICE_INTERFACE), 0, userHandle);
            int numAvailable = available.size();

            if (numAvailable == 0) {
                Slog.w(TAG, "no available voice recognition services found for user " + userHandle);
                return null;
            } else {
                if (prefPackage != null) {
                    for (int i=0; i<numAvailable; i++) {
                        ServiceInfo serviceInfo = available.get(i).serviceInfo;
                        if (prefPackage.equals(serviceInfo.packageName)) {
                            return new ComponentName(serviceInfo.packageName, serviceInfo.name);
                        }
                    }
                }
                if (numAvailable > 1) {
                    Slog.w(TAG, "more than one voice recognition service found, picking first");
                }

                ServiceInfo serviceInfo = available.get(0).serviceInfo;
                return new ComponentName(serviceInfo.packageName, serviceInfo.name);
            }
        }

        ComponentName getCurRecognizer(int userHandle) {
            String curRecognizer = Settings.Secure.getStringForUser(
                    mContext.getContentResolver(),
                    Settings.Secure.VOICE_RECOGNITION_SERVICE, userHandle);
            if (TextUtils.isEmpty(curRecognizer)) {
                return null;
            }
            if (DEBUG) Slog.i(TAG, "getCurRecognizer curRecognizer=" + curRecognizer
                    + " user=" + userHandle);
            return ComponentName.unflattenFromString(curRecognizer);
        }

        void setCurRecognizer(ComponentName comp, int userHandle) {
            Settings.Secure.putStringForUser(mContext.getContentResolver(),
                    Settings.Secure.VOICE_RECOGNITION_SERVICE,
                    comp != null ? comp.flattenToShortString() : "", userHandle);
            if (DEBUG) Slog.i(TAG, "setCurRecognizer comp=" + comp
                    + " user=" + userHandle);
        }
